The Troubling Trend of Retractions
Retractions are becoming increasingly common, with journals retracting papers for various reasons, from image duplication to compromised peer review processes. What's particularly alarming is the sheer number of retractions, with over 65,000 in the Retraction Watch Database and 450 entries in the Hijacked Journal Checker. Research Misconduct in China
China's National Health Commission disclosed 28 cases of research misconduct, including data fabrication and guest authorship. This is a significant development, as it indicates a growing awareness of research integrity issues in China. However, it also raises questions about the prevalence of such misconduct globally. Gender Disparities in Publishing
A study reveals that women publish fewer articles per year and tend to publish in lower-impact factor journals, resulting in fewer citations. This is a concerning trend that demands attention.
